Solve the following inequality. 12x + 40 < 304
x = 18
x < 22
x > 24
x = 25
To solve the inequality 12x + 40 < 304, subtract 40 from both sides:
12x + 40 - 40 < 304 - 40
12x < 264
Then, divide both sides by 12 to isolate x:
12x/12 < 264/12
x < 22
Therefore, the correct answer is x < 22.
